#b7e4e5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b7e4e5 is composed of 71.8% red, 89.4% green and 89.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 20.1% cyan, 0.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 181.3 degrees, a saturation of 46.9% and a lightness of 80.8%. #b7e4e5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#6fc9cb.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

Shades and Tints of #b7e4e5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f1fafa is the lightest one.
